Buying Guide
What matters most when building a Beetle-based dune buggy?
Consider compatibility with air-cooled VW platforms, the level of DIY capability, and whether you prioritize interior comfort, suspension strength, or detailed reference material.
Interior vs. performance upgrades
- Interior: Carpet kits and footrests improve cabin feel and reduce noise, but may need trimming.
- Performance: Solid mount kits and beef-up trailing arm kits improve stability and durability on rough terrain.
- Reference material: Manuals help plan and execute complex builds, reducing trial-and-error work.
Compatibility check: how to verify before buying
- Verify year range and model (Beetle 58-70 vs 69-79 IRS trailing arms) to avoid mismatches.
- Confirm that the kit is designed for VW-based dune buggies or air-cooled platforms.
- Check finish options (painted vs raw) to align with your project aesthetics and corrosion resistance needs.

FAQ
- What is a solid mount kit used for in a dune buggy? Answer: It reduces drivetrain movement and vibration by securing engine/transmission mounts.
- Is a raw, unpainted kit okay for a buggy project? Answer: It can be customized and painted to match, but may require corrosion protection.
- Are these parts compatible with all Beetle years? Answer: Compatibility varies by model year and drivetrain, verify with product details.
- Do I need a manual to build a dune buggy? Answer: A comprehensive manual helps with planning, assembly steps, and understanding VW-based systems.
- Can interior carpet kits fit any Beetle interior? Answer: They are designed for specific Beetle ranges; trimming may be needed for exact fit.
